A Film That Blended Romance And Suspense: Released in 1992, The Bodyguard brought together romance, drama, and thriller elements in a way few movies had done before. Directed by Mick Jackson, the film follows former Secret Service agent Frank Farmer, played by Kevin Costner, who is hired to protect global music star Rachel Marron, portrayed by Whitney Houston. At its core, the story explores trust between two people from very different worlds. Farmer is disciplined and cautious, while Marron lives under constant public attention. The tension between safety and fame drives the film forward, giving audiences both emotional depth and suspense.

The NFL’s Shift From Opposition To Embrace: For decades, the National Football League strongly opposed sports gambling. League leaders believed betting could threaten the integrity of games and damage public trust. That position changed after the U.S. Supreme Court struck down a federal ban on sports betting in 2018, allowing individual states to legalize it. Instead of resisting the change, the NFL adjusted its strategy. The league recognized that legalized betting was growing quickly across the United States and decided to become part of the industry rather than fight against it. This shift marked one of the biggest business transformations in modern sports history. Today, sports gambling is deeply connected to how fans watch, discuss, and interact with NFL games.

The Average Age Of First-Time Buyers Today: For many years, buying a first home was seen as something people did in their twenties. That idea has changed. According to recent housing market data from the National Association of Realtors, the average age of a first-time homebuyer in the United States is now about 35 to 36 years old. This is significantly older than past generations. In the early 1980s, the typical first-time buyer was closer to age 29. This shift reflects broader economic and social changes. Higher home prices, student loan debt, and changing career paths have all pushed homeownership later into adulthood. Today’s buyers often spend more time renting while building savings and improving credit. Understanding this new average helps set realistic expectations for people planning to buy their first home.

The Origin Of Casino Money Superstitions: Casinos have always mixed mathematics with human emotion. While games are based on probability, players often rely on rituals and beliefs to feel more in control. Over time, gamblers created traditions around lucky numbers, colors, seating positions, and even specific types of money. One of the most well-known examples involves the $50 bill. In many casinos across the United States, it is nicknamed a “frog.” Some players and dealers consider it unlucky, and this belief has lasted for decades despite having no mathematical basis. Superstitions grow easily in gambling environments because wins and losses feel personal. Players naturally search for patterns, even when outcomes are random.

A Banking System On The Brink: In the early 1930s, the United States faced one of the worst financial crises in its history. The Great Depression caused businesses to fail, unemployment to rise, and banks across the country to collapse. Between 1929 and early 1933, thousands of banks closed their doors. Millions of Americans lost their savings because deposits were not protected. At that time, banks operated with little federal oversight. If a bank failed, customers had no guarantee they would get their money back. Fear spread quickly, leading people to rush to banks and withdraw their savings all at once. These events were known as bank runs, and they often pushed otherwise stable banks into failure. By 1933, public trust in the banking system had nearly disappeared. Restoring confidence became one of the federal government’s most urgent challenges.

A Quiet Flight Turns Into A Crime: On November 24, 1971, the night before Thanksgiving, a man using the name Dan Cooper boarded Northwest Orient Airlines Flight 305 in Portland, Oregon. The flight was a short trip to Seattle, Washington, carrying passengers expecting a routine journey. Cooper appeared calm, dressed in a business suit, white shirt, and tie, blending in with other travelers. Shortly after takeoff, he handed a flight attendant a note stating that he had a bomb. He opened his briefcase to show wires and red cylinders, convincing the crew that the threat was real. Cooper demanded $200,000 in cash, four parachutes, and a refueling truck waiting in Seattle. He also instructed the crew to follow his orders carefully to keep passengers safe. The calm way he handled the situation surprised investigators later. Cooper did not panic or harm anyone during the hijacking.

A New Kind Of Arcade Hero: In 1980, the Japanese company Namco released a video game that would change the direction of the gaming industry. Pac-Man was created by game designer Toru Iwatani, who wanted to design a game that appealed to a wider audience beyond action and shooting games. At the time, arcades were dominated by space combat titles, but Pac-Man introduced a different experience focused on strategy, timing, and movement. The game featured a simple yellow character navigating a maze while eating dots and avoiding enemies. Its easy-to-understand design made it accessible to players of all ages. Instead of violence, the gameplay centered on survival and pattern recognition, which helped Pac-Man stand out in crowded arcades. The game quickly became a global success and helped expand video gaming into mainstream entertainment.

The Origin Of Amsterdam’s Canals: Amsterdam, often called the "Venice of the North," is famous for its intricate network of canals. The city has 165 canals stretching over 60 miles, designed in the 17th century during the Dutch Golden Age. These canals were built to manage water, expand the city, and support trade. They are arranged in concentric belts, known as the Grachtengordel, which divide the city into residential, commercial, and cultural areas. The canals are still an essential part of city planning, combining functionality with aesthetic appeal.

The Birth Of A New Way To Pay: In 1950, Diners Club made history by becoming the first independent credit card company in the world. The idea came from Frank McNamara, who reportedly forgot his wallet while dining at a restaurant in New York City. This moment led him to imagine a new way to pay without carrying cash. Soon after, Diners Club introduced a card that allowed members to pay for meals at select restaurants and settle the bill later. This simple idea created the foundation for modern credit systems used today.

The Rise Of A Financial Illusion: In 1920 and 1921, Charles Ponzi became widely known for running one of the most famous financial scams in history. Living in New England, Ponzi convinced thousands of people to invest in what he claimed was a profitable opportunity involving international postage stamps. He promised investors high returns in a short time, often claiming they could double their money in just 90 days. At a time when many people were looking for ways to grow their savings, the offer seemed too good to ignore.

Where Kharg Island Is Located: Kharg Island is a small but strategically important island in the northern part of the Persian Gulf. It belongs to the country of Iran and lies about 25 kilometers (15 miles) off the Iranian mainland. Although the island is only about 8 kilometers (5 miles) long, it plays a major role in the global oil industry. The island’s location makes it ideal for shipping routes across the Persian Gulf. Tankers carrying oil from Iran often pass through this region on their way to markets in Asia, Europe, and other parts of the world. Because of this position, Kharg Island has become one of the most important oil export terminals in the Middle East.

What Johnson’s Baby Oil Is: Johnson's Baby Oil has been a familiar product in homes for generations. First created as part of the company’s baby care line, the oil was designed to help protect delicate skin from dryness. Over time, it became popular with adults as well because of its simple formula and reliable performance. The product is mainly made from mineral oil, a purified ingredient commonly used in skincare. Mineral oil forms a protective layer on the skin that helps trap moisture. Instead of adding water to the skin, it prevents water already in the skin from evaporating too quickly.
